Biography contributed by Elizabeth Allen

Victor Ingleby WARHURST was born in Hyde Park, South Australia on 22nd January, 1918

His parents were Victor Arnold WARHURST & Olive Drew SHARLAND

He married Joan Shirley VERCO in Christ Church in North Adelaide in 1940 - one daughter Patricia who never met her Father

He had graduated from the Royal Military College in Duntroon & enlisted in Paddington, Sydney on 12th November, 1940

Victor was Killed in Action in Malaya on 11th February, 1942 - no known grave

His name is memorialised on the Australian War Memorial & the Singapore (Kranji) Memorial

--------

His twin brother Raymond Wilfred WARHURST (SN SX 1735) also served during WW2 as a Lieutenant and was discharged on 9th October, 1945
